Abstract

The invention provides a dust removal mechanism for a power distribution cabinet. The dust removal mechanism comprises a power distribution cabinet body, a dust collection box and dust collection equipment, wherein the dust collection box is arranged at the back of the interior of the power distribution cabinet body, the dust collection box comprises an upper cavity and a lower cavity, a pluralityof dust collection pipes are arranged on the front end face of the upper cavity, the dust collection pipes are used for connecting the inner cavity of the power distribution cabinet body with the upper cavity, a partition plate is arranged between the lower cavity and the upper cavity, and a dust falling opening for connecting the lower cavity with the upper cavity is formed in the partition plate; the dust collection equipment is arranged at the back of the exterior of the power distribution cabinet body, the dust collection equipment comprises a dust collector, a connecting pipe, a dust collection bag and a connecting flange which are connected in sequence, the front end of the connecting flange is mounted on a connecting port in the lower part of the power distribution cabinet body, the connecting port is connected with the dust collection opening formed in the rear side wall of the lower cavity, and the dust collection opening is used for connecting the lower cavity with the innerhole of the connecting flange. According to the dust removal mechanism for the power distribution cabinet provided by the invention, dust collection can be carried out on the power distribution cabinet, and the operation is convenient.

Background technique [0002] The power distribution cabinet is the final equipment of the power distribution system. A large number of connectors and electronic components are installed in the power distribution cabinet. During use, the components in the power distribution cabinet are easily covered by dust, and then absorb the dust in the air. Moisture is easy to corrode exposed components and shorten the service life of components. Long-term use may cause low insulation, short circuit and other faults, and may even cause the risk of electric shock. Therefore, it is necessary to remove dust inside the power distribution cabinet.
